Dude I love this thing! It's so versatile and has far surpassed the off-road capability that I wanted. It absolutely loves trails and the factory rack system can hold about any type of toy you could want. I'd be happy to tell you anything else you wanted to know, just PM me.
My bit of advice- spring for an '09 or newer. Earlier models and SMOD issue with a transmission-radiator linked cooling system that was a POS. 2009 models (like mine) and newer had it fixed.
